ewok moon
Andromeda
- 2025-04-16T00:00:00.000000Z
Floating
- 2025-02-05T00:00:00.000000Z
Radio Solis
- 2024-10-10T00:00:00.000000Z
Naboo
- 2024-03-27T00:00:00.000000Z
Similar Artists